Tehran strongly condemns the latest Israeli aggression on Syrian territories

The Iranian Foreign Ministry has condemned in the strongest terms the Israeli aggression which at dawn on Friday targeted military points in the vicinity of Damascus and killed 3 soldiers and wounded 7 others, stressing that this aggression is a blatant violation of the Syrian sovereignty.

In a statement on Friday, the ministry’s Spokesman Nasser Kan’ani said that the continuous Zionist attacks on the Syrian territory constitute a blatant violation of the country’s sovereignty and territorial integrity as well as the relevant international laws and principles.  He regretted the suspicious silence of the concerned international organizations and the human rights “advocates” over the illegal Israeli behavior.

Kan’ani called on the international community, particularly the Security Council to assume its responsibilities towards putting an end to the Israeli dangerous practices, expressing his condolences to Syria, as a government and people, and to the families of the victims of this aggression.
